Within-city ZIP comparison

Where the ZIP codes inside Lexington differ

Housing values create the stronger within-city contrast here. ZIP 29073 has a median home value of $216,300, compared with $332,400 in 29072. Use the city average for a broad profile, then compare these ZIP pages when a housing decision depends on the local market.

ZIP Codes in Lexington, SC

These ZIP codes sit in Lexington County, which covers 14 ZIP codes in all; 2 of them fall in Lexington. See the Lexington County roll-up →

Lexington sits in the upper half of Lexington County on income: Columbia, West Columbia and Gaston report less, while Chapin reports more. Batesburg marks the far end of that range at $50,379, 45% below Lexington.
